Analysis

In 2024, government vs private aid by recipient in Wallis and Futuna stood at 153.40 million.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 6.8% on the previous year and up 56.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, government vs private aid by recipient in Wallis and Futuna peaked at 164.67 million in 2023 and was at its lowest, 7,038, in 1993.

Wallis and Futuna ranks 109th of 178 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 5.54 million 5.54 million 5.54 million 1
1970s 9.16 million 1.34 million 21.64 million 10
1980s 7.51 million 109,402 21.35 million 10
1990s 15.57 million 7,038 76.61 million 10
2000s 98.38 million 74.28 million 123.28 million 10
2010s 108.21 million 52.00 million 129.79 million 10
2020s 133.73 million 111.65 million 164.67 million 5
